Battipaglia (pronounced [ˌbattiˈpaʎʎa]) is a town and comune in the Province of Salerno, in the Campania region of southern Italy. With around 50,000 inhabitants, it is one of the most populous municipalities in the province after Salerno itself, and the main agricultural, industrial and railway hub of the SeleRead more
Plain.
The town is internationally renowned for the production of buffalo mozzarella. Beyond dairy farming, the surrounding plain is one of the most intensively cultivated areas of southern Italy, producing artichokes, tomatoes, tobacco and fruit, and is a leading centre for the cultivation of rocket and pre-washed bagged salads, much of it processed locally for the national and European retail market.
